The Ultimate Guide To what is md5 technology
The Ultimate Guide To what is md5 technology
Blog Article
MD5 is usually even now Employed in cybersecurity to verify and authenticate digital signatures. Working with MD5, a user can verify that a downloaded file is genuine by matching the private and non-private key and hash values. Due to higher fee of MD5 collisions, having said that, this message-digest algorithm isn't ideal for verifying the integrity of knowledge or files as menace actors can certainly swap the hash value with one among their own personal.
It absolutely was produced by Ronald Rivest in 1991 and is often used for knowledge integrity verification, such as making sure the authenticity and consistency of data files or messages.
Unfold the loveWith the world wide web remaining flooded with a myriad of freeware apps and application, it’s tough to differentiate in between the authentic and the doubtless damaging kinds. That is ...
As outlined by eWeek, a identified weak point while in the MD5 hash purpose gave the group of threat actors at the rear of the Flame malware the chance to forge a sound certificate for your Microsoft's Windows Update company.
MD5 and also other cryptographic hash algorithms are just one-way capabilities, this means they aren’t used to encrypt files—it’s not possible to reverse the hashing process to Get well the initial facts.
Even though it's intended for a cryptographic purpose, MD5 suffers from intensive vulnerabilities, And that's why you should stay clear of it In terms of preserving your CMS, Internet framework, along with other programs that use passwords for granting accessibility.
If we return to the 4 lines which the hashing visualization Instrument gave us, you will notice that the third line suggests:
This exclusive hash worth is intended to be nearly impossible to reverse engineer, rendering it a highly effective Device for verifying info integrity in the course of communication and storage.
Also, the MD5 algorithm generates a fixed dimensions hash— Regardless of how significant or modest your input facts is, the output hash will always be a similar size. This uniformity is a wonderful attribute, especially when comparing hashes or storing them.
To avoid wasting time, we will utilize a hexadecimal to decimal converter to accomplish the do the job for us. Whenever we enter in our hexadecimal hash, we realize that:
MD5 will work by having an input (message) and adhering to a number of techniques To combine and compress check here the data, combining it with constants and inner condition variables, in the long run developing a fixed-size output hash.
It truly is such as uniquely identifiable taste that's still left with your mouth When you've eaten your spaghetti—distinctive, unchangeable, and impossible to reverse back into its unique elements.
Padding the Concept: MD5 operates on set-sizing blocks of information. To handle messages of various lengths, the enter message is padded to the length that is a multiple of 512 bits. This padding makes certain that even a small alter during the input message makes a special hash benefit.
Considering that we have now discussed how the message digest algorithm (MD5) in hashing isn't the most safe selection to choose from, there's a chance you're wondering — what can I use rather? Nicely, I'm glad you asked. Let's discover a number of the alternate options.